Requirements

  • Looking for a 6-month internship
  • English is a no-brainer (fully professional capability)
  • First experience as a Data analyst or in Consulting
  • Great analytical skills to identify key business insights & can share recommendations through impactful visualizations
  • Very comfortable with data, you know how to use Excel and Dataviz tools are no secret to you (Ideally Tableau)
  • Good command of SQL, Python is a plus
  • You are an amazing team player ready for a fast-paced work environment, have good communication skills and a lot of drive with a can-do / will-do attitude

Responsibilities

  • Build and rebuild KPIs and dashboards using SQL and Tableau to improve how we monitor our performance and therefore how we take decisions.
  • Support defining targets and building strategies from analyzing performance for all teams across multiple data points: quality, supply, product, marketing.
  • Help build the data infrastructure (data collection + table creation + maintenance) necessary to bring the KPIs to life.
  • Conduct ad hoc analysis to support strategic decision and share your insights to the senior managers (ex : launch of a new feature, launch of a new payment method, category extension, etc.)

Mission & Purpose

Founded in 2014 by Thibaud Hug de Larauze, Quentin Le Brouster, and Vianney Vaute, Back Market is a global marketplace for premium refurbished electronics. We’re here to help make refurbished tech trustworthy, reliable, and affordable. As a certified B-Corp, Back Market’s mission is to do more with what we already have. Because, well, what we already have is pretty great. That’s why all the tech you find on Back Market is better than new — because not only is it in perfect working condition, independent scientific research shows that refurbished electronics have a significantly smaller footprint on the environment than brand new. Every time someone chooses refurbished tech, we avoid additional environmental impact on the planet. Of course, it’s not just about the tech sold by sellers on our marketplace, it’s also about how we run our business — we hold ourselves to high standards when it comes to our own sustainability practices, too. We work across the refurbishment industry to develop new technologies, support environmental initiatives related to electronic waste (e-waste), and work with local governments across the globe to pass legislation that supports sustainability and the Right to Repair in the tech industry. We know we’re not alone in our vision for a world where tech respects the planet. With 884M€ raised to date and over 10 million customers around the world, we’re well on our way to the joyful revolution of Tech Reborn.
